This death sauce goes straight for the habaneros. It's not just pure spice like a lot of crazy-hot sauces, though thanks to honey and garlic, it'll be a sweet death loaded with flavor.

15 habanero chiles, stems removed, seeds left in
7 ounces Asian garlic chili pepper sauce
1/4 cup honey
3 cloves garlic, minced
Add the peppers, garlic sauce, honey, and garlic to a blender or food processor. Process on high speed until the mixture is pureed.
Store in an airtight jar in the refrigerator. Will keep for up to 6 months.
Use as a hot sauce or marinade.
